The Lead Independent Director of Blink Charging Co. (NASDAQ:BLNK), Jack Levine, Just Bought 5.7% More Shares

Potential Blink Charging Co. (NASDAQ:BLNK) shareholders may wish to note that the Lead Independent Director, Jack Levine, recently bought US$109k worth of stock, paying US$18.18 for each share. While that's a very decent purchase to our minds, it was proportionally a bit modest, boosting their holding by just 5.7%.

Blink Charging Insider Transactions Over The Last Year

In fact, the recent purchase by Jack Levine was the biggest purchase of Blink Charging shares made by an insider individual in the last twelve months, according to our records. So it's clear an insider wanted to buy, even at a higher price than the current share price (being US$17.19). Their view may have changed since then, but at least it shows they felt optimistic at the time. To us, it's very important to consider the price insiders pay for shares. It is encouraging to see an insider paid above the current price for shares, as it suggests they saw value, even at higher levels. Jack Levine was the only individual insider to buy shares in the last twelve months.

Does Blink Charging Boast High Insider Ownership?

Many investors like to check how much of a company is owned by insiders. A high insider ownership often makes company leadership more mindful of shareholder interests. Blink Charging insiders own about US$101m worth of shares (which is 14% of the company). Most shareholders would be happy to see this sort of insider ownership, since it suggests that management incentives are well aligned with other shareholders.
